Hotel Mozart is a 3-star retreat in Brussels, Belgium, just 0.4mi from the city center. The address is Rue Marche Aux Fromages, 23, placing this spot close to the heart of town. Breakfast is offered, and the amenity lineup includes free Wifi, a terrace, a 24-hour front desk, non-smoking rooms, a patio, an elevator, extra-long beds (> 6.5 ft), a balcony, and views.
With 3,841 reviews, travelers have shared plenty of experiences at Hotel Mozart. Price starts from $85.
From this Brussels base, enjoy the comfort of balcony and terrace views, plus practical touches like an elevator and a 24-hour front desk to make every stay easy.
Brussels-bound travelers will find a playful base at Hotel Mozart, showcasing a diverse lineup of rooms. Options range from Single Room to more expansive choices such as Deluxe, Garden View, Royal Suite, and various Suite configurations like Suite, Queen. Many rooms come with balconies or garden views, while terrace or patio spaces invite lingering over city light and fresh air.
With a chorus of reviews (3,841), the stay earns praise for practical touches that keep days rolling—elevator access, a 24-hour front desk, and reliable free Wifi. Breakfast is on offer to start adventures, and non-smoking rooms help create a comfortable atmosphere after wandering Brussels’ streets and markets.
Prices start from $85, and payment options include Cash as well as Visa, Diners Club, American Express, and Mastercard, making planning for a Brussels escape straightforward.

This hotel is so beautiful, and made our stay in Brussels so enjoyable. The images barely do it justice, so much colour and excitement, everywhere you turn. It's like a baroque Mozart visits Morocco vibe. Winding corridors and staircases and internal courtyards. There were even some cats and kittens hanging around, playing with children. The owner is very friendly and fun, and gave us tea in the evening to relax. The rooms are not very modern or updated, the bathroom was very basic, but I saw that as part of the charm. That said, we had good wi-fi and our beds were nice and firm, we slept very well (actually the best hotel bed I've slept in for ages - I'm not a fan of soft hotel beds). If you like a modern and minimalist place - this probably isn't for you - but the character/warmth of the place is amazing. Also the location is right in the middle of town, seconds from the main square and minutes from central station, but our room was very quiet still.
Breakfast is quite basic - some bread/croissant, butter, jam and slices of cheese, coffee and juice only. Some egg/meat/fruit would make it a bit better. But it is what it is - and the hotel was very well priced so we were very happy given the budget.
